Nuno Mendes Unveils His Journey: From Debut to Dream Move at PSG

Nuno Mendes, a 22-year-old full-back who plays for both Paris Saint-Germain and Portugal, was the guest of Alexandre Ruiz. Free Ligue 1 He discussed his initial years in the profession, his transition to Sporting Lisbon, and subsequently his shift to PSG.

Have you always dreamed of becoming a footballer?

Absolutely, all the time. However, I wasn't actively seeking out a club. My friends and I were hanging around the streets when it was that same teacher whom you pointed out who led me to join the club. He happened to be my gym instructor, and he would transport me to practice sessions using his vehicle before dropping me home afterward. This routine continued daily following school hours.

Was his name Bruno?

His name was Bruno.

Does he take you for a two-hour drive every day?

Certainly, but not daily; it was only on three days each week.

Were you wearing that blue shirt?

Sure, but I didn’t have any shoes, see? Somebody loaned them to me.

Whose shoes are they?

The shoes belong to me; they were given to me by my teammate’s mom, specifically the captain’s mother. All I wanted were some shoes to play with in the streets since I didn’t have any at all.

So your team leader’s mother handed over his shoes to you as a present?

Indeed, you're correct; his name is Fabio.

What led Sporting to seek you out?

It happened during a tournament. The person who took me to Sporting noticed me. He mentioned wanting to speak with me, yet at that point, I wasn't aware of his identity. He stated, "I represent Sporting; I came specifically to watch you play, and I really liked your style." After the game, we did not cross paths again.

It was a story I've recounted numerous times. That particular day, while I was at school, I stepped out for some reason. He trailed me back to my house and rang the bell. Honestly, I had no clue who he was. When I answered the door, all I saw was a knife. Then, he reassured me saying, "Don't be afraid; I'm just here as a Sports Recruiter."

Who is this man?

His name is Aderita. At Sporting, he would assist players who had very little. He'd provide them with cards to purchase food at the shops.

Was he some sort of patron?

Yes, he was.

How do you feel about sporting events?

Nearly everything, since Sporting bestowed upon me all these things. They have been instrumental in my life both on and off the field. They provided immense support. There was an individual who, during my time at Sporting, would take me home daily.

I would ride the bus for my training sessions, and afterward, he'd drive me back home because it had become quite late. Our practice started at 6 p.m., and once we finished, typically about 9 p.m., it was too late to catch the bus again.

I was too young back then, which is why he would always bring me along with him. Nowadays, I occasionally chat with him, and his name is Senhor Vicente. That’s how we addressed him in those days. In the past, he would often take both me and some of my coworkers home.

How was your joining ceremony with PSG?

I participated in the selection process. At the final moment, after speaking with my agent, I informed him of my desire to someday play for Paris Saint-Germain.

Did you really?

Sure, and thus he informed me just moments before that PSG had shown interest in me. Without hesitation, I agreed to sign. With only 2 minutes remaining until the transfer window closed, we managed to pull through. Here I stand now.
